Sec. 805. Talc-containing cosmetics

The Secretary of Health and Human Services— not later than one year after the date of enactment of this Act, shall promulgate proposed regulations to establish and require standardized testing methods for detecting and identifying asbestos in talc-containing cosmetic products; and not later than 180 days after the date on which the public comment period on the proposed regulations closes, shall issue such final regulations.
